Palestine Action activists released without charge after Elbit occupation
TWO pro-Palestinian activists who occupied and damaged the London headquarters of Israeli arms manufacturer Elbit Systems have been released by police without charge, despite staging their protest in public view in the heart of the capital.
The pair are among dozens of Palestine Action supporters who have been released without charge after carrying out operations against Elbit, triggering accusations that the company fears what information about its activities might be publicly revealed if protesters’ cases came to court.
In Britain, Elbit makes components for drones that are supplied to the Israeli military and have been used in attacks on Gaza.
